COMMERCIAL PROPERTY MANAGEMENT ACCOUNTANT
Job Summary:
General Accounting position is primarily responsible for the accounts payable function which consists of the payment of goods and services required for daily operations. Additional duties include compiling, maintaining, and auditing AP records for accuracy and to ensure proper accounting procedures. Perform various general accounting duties such as month-end closing processes, assisting with reporting and resolution of discrepancies for the Accounting Department. / Property Management Department. calculate management fees, owner distributions, and provide audit-ready financial statements. Assist in the annual budget preparation and in the annual tax return preparation with the CPA. Completes various financial, accounting, administrative, and other reports, and analysis, and performs other duties as assigned or as necessary.
